(graphic: Chris Gash) NYTimes.Com By DENNIS OVERBYE Not so for the proton, the subatomic particle that anchors atoms and is the building block of all ordinary matter, of stars, planets and people. Physicists announced last week that a new experiment had shown that the proton is about 4 percent smaller than they thought.
Instead of celebration, however, the result has caused consternation. Such a big discrepancy, say the physicists, led by Randolf Pohl of the Max Planck Institute for Quantum Optics in Garching, Germany, could mean that the most accurate theory in the history of physics, quantum electrodynamics, which describes how light and matter interact, is in trouble.
“What you have is a result that actually shocked us,” said Paul Rabinowitz, a chemist from Princeton University, who was a member of Dr. Pohl’s team.
The results were published in Nature. Protons, of course, have not shrunk. They have been whatever size they are ever since they congealed out of a primordial soup of energy and even smaller particles — quarks and gluons — in the early moments of the Big Bang.
